What does the List Rippling Departments action do in Rippling?
Returns org-chart departments with manager info. Useful for resolving department IDs in routing rules or for "team-by-team headcount" reporting.

What happens if Rippling returns an error?
The run history shows the failed step with its input and the error message Rippling returned, so you can fix the input and run the workflow again. Automatic retries are built into HTTP steps only, where you can also set your own retry count and delay.
Does List Rippling Departments support batch operations?
Run List Rippling Departments inside a loop to process each item in an array. TinyCommand does not throttle calls for you, so for large arrays add a Delay step if you need to stay within Rippling's rate limits.
